The winners for the V Shantaram awards have been announced and A Wednesday, Taare Zameen Par and Jodhaa Akbar took home most of the honours.

The biggest honour of the night, the Gold Award for Best Film, went to Aamir Khan’s Taare Zameen Par. The film also was awarded the silver award for Best Director for Aamir Khan. Child artist Darsheel Safary was named the Best Actor of the year for his brilliant portrayal of a child with Dyslexia in the film. Also Amol Gupte was presented the Best Writer Award for the film.

A Wednesday was honoured with five awards including: The coveted Gold Award for Best Director for Neeraj Pandey and he also won the Best Debut Director Award. The film was given the Silver Award for Best Film. Jimmy Shergill was named Best Artiste in a Supporting Role for his work and the award for Best Editing went to Shree Narayan Singh.

Aishwarya Rai Bachchan was honoured for her work in Jodhaa Akbar as Best Actress and the award was picked up by her mother in law Jaya Bachchan who said, “Wonderful, carry on working as you have in Jodhaa Akbar.” The films director Ashutosh Gowariker received the Best Director Bronze Award. A R Rahman also won Best Music Director for his score for the film while the Best Cinematography Award went to Kiran Deohans.

Farhan Akhtar was named Best Debut for his outstanding performance in Rock On!! About winning the award he said, “I am really thankful for this one. You know for this one (the award) there is a very difficult, stiff competition with two very cute kids and with my wife from the film (Prachi Desai). I am very-very thankful and grateful.”

In other awards The Bronze Award for Best Film went to the Marathi film Tingya while the Best Sound award went to late H Sridhar for the Tamil film Dashavataram.
